I bookmarked the page. Thank you so much for that. About the passport-size photographs, I have here one left from G325A, my question is, can I scan this and print on my own?

Scanning the photo will not work. Since you have lot of time for NVC, ask her to send 2 more photographs. Anyway, she needs to take 12 to 16 photographs until the interview.

Hehe, silly question. I should have sent only one photo from G325A. Anyway, is that ok? About the original birth and marriage certificates, I sent originals to USCIS when I filed I-130 and 129F,

You were NOT supposed to send the originals to the USCIS with I-130. They will NEITHER return it to you NOR to forward to NVC. Only way you can get them back is, after I-130 completion you need to contact USCIS to return it back by filling the form G-884 (http://www.uscis.gov/portal/site/uscis/menuitem.5af9bb95919f35e66f614176543f6d1a/?vgnextoid=dccb5d4c6608e010VgnVCM1000000ecd190aRCRD&vgnextchannel=db029c7755cb9010VgnVCM10000045f3d6a1RCRD)

what I have now left is Certified True Copy, so will they accept this,

NVC will accept the Certified Copies. But still you need the originals at the Interview.

won't the USCIS send my original files to NVC?

NO

It just cost more money to order it in the Philippines and have them send it to me again. But I will do that if that's the option left.

Please refer the above note to get the originals back after I-130 completion. Otherwise, originals will be part of your file with the USCIS.

So, I have an additional question. I'm living with mom, dad, and sister but she's now lodging near her school. If my mom will co-sponsor me to bring my wife over, how many household unit are we? What is the 125% poverty line in this situation? Oh, dad is working in the government but only mom will be the one who will sign the papers. So, she will be the co-sponsor only.

A man shall leave his father and his mother, and be joined to his wife; and they shall become one flesh. – Genesis 2:24

Link to comment
Share on other sites

Filed: IR-5 Country: India
Timeline

So, I have an additional question. I'm living with mom, dad, and sister but she's now lodging near her school. If my mom will co-sponsor me to bring my wife over, how many household unit are we? What is the 125% poverty line in this situation? Oh, dad is working in the government but only mom will be the one who will sign the papers. So, she will be the co-sponsor only.

If your mom has filed separate tax return in the last years, her household is 1.

If your mom has filed joint tax return with your father last years, her household is 2.

If your mom has filed separate tax return with your sister as dependent in the last years, her household is 2.

If your mom has filed joint tax return with your father and sister is dependent in her return last years, her household is 3.

Plus, you and your wife are always included - 2.

Now you can derive the total household size and the poverty guideline is here: http://www.uscis.gov/files/form/i-864p.pdf
